Understanding Rotary Die Cutting Machines
First off, for those who aren't super familiar, a rotary die cutting machine is a piece of equipment used in various industries, like packaging, printing, and textile. It's designed to cut, slit, and score materials such as paper, cardboard, plastic films, and fabrics with high precision. The basic principle involves a rotating die cylinder that presses against a material web to make the cuts.
Factors Affecting Operating Speed
Material Type
The type of material you're working with plays a huge role in how fast the machine can run. For instance, thin and flexible materials like plastic films can usually be processed at a much higher speed compared to thick and rigid materials like cardboard. Plastic films are more compliant and can easily pass through the cutting mechanism without causing much resistance. On the other hand, cardboard is denser and may require more force to cut, which can slow down the machine.
Die Complexity
The complexity of the die also matters. A simple die with straight cuts and basic shapes can operate at a faster speed than a die with intricate patterns and detailed designs. When the die has complex shapes, the machine has to make more precise movements and adjustments, which takes more time. For example, a die that cuts out a simple rectangle can work much quicker than one that cuts a detailed logo with curves and fine lines.
Machine Design and Quality
The design and quality of the rotary die cutting machine itself are crucial. High - quality machines with advanced features and better engineering can generally operate at higher speeds. These machines are built with more precise components, better control systems, and efficient power transmission mechanisms. They can handle the stress and wear of high - speed operation more effectively. For example, a well - designed machine may have a better lubrication system that reduces friction and allows the moving parts to operate smoothly at high speeds.
Typical Operating Speeds
Now, let's talk about some typical operating speeds. In general, a standard rotary die cutting machine can operate at speeds ranging from 50 to 200 meters per minute. However, this is a very broad range, and the actual speed can vary depending on the factors we just discussed.


For simple jobs involving thin materials like plastic films, some high - end machines can reach speeds of up to 300 meters per minute or even higher. These High Speed Rotary Die - slitting Machine are specifically designed for high - volume production where speed is of the essence.
On the other hand, when working with thick materials or complex dies, the speed may drop to as low as 20 - 30 meters per minute. This is because the machine needs to take its time to ensure accurate cuts and avoid any damage to the material or the die.
Double Station Machines
Double station rotary die cutting machines offer an interesting option when it comes to speed. These Double Station Rotary Die - slitting Machine have two cutting stations that can work simultaneously or in an alternating pattern. This means that while one station is cutting, the other can be set up for the next job or performing other tasks. As a result, they can significantly increase the overall production speed. In some cases, double - station machines can achieve speeds that are almost double that of a single - station machine, depending on the job requirements.
Improving Machine Speed
If you're looking to increase the operating speed of your rotary die cutting machine, there are a few things you can do. First, make sure to use the right materials for the job. As we mentioned earlier, choosing the appropriate material can have a big impact on speed. Second, invest in high - quality dies. A well - made die will not only cut more accurately but also allow the machine to operate at a faster pace.
Regular maintenance is also key. Keeping the machine clean, lubricated, and properly calibrated will ensure that it runs smoothly and efficiently. Replace worn - out parts promptly to avoid any slowdowns or breakdowns.
